Formula

Vanguard FTSE Social Index Fund Admiral hypothetical price = Vanguard FTSE Social Index Fund Admiral current price x (Royal Bank of Canada market cap / Vanguard FTSE Social Index Fund Admiral aum / fund size).

Context

ETF and fund comparisons use AUM or fund size where available. Fund share counts and ETF creation/redemption mechanics mean this is a size benchmark, not a price forecast.
